Our method

Our long-term goal of achieving the Society of Agreement by 2050 is very ambitious. What pragmatic and concrete method are we using to move in this direction and achieve our goal on time?

We can summarise our method as follows: a multitude of small steps, all moving in the same direction, which ultimately create positive tipping points when a critical mass has been reached.

The main features of our method are as follows:

  1. Our activity is structured around projects, initiated and led by members of our Community*, in a free and decentralised manner.
  2. The CosmoPolitical Cooperative provides the practical (our IT system) and institutional (our statutes and our code of good conduct) framework, where each member of our Community can freely initiate a project and see it supported by others, or support a project initiated by someone else by participating in the working group set up to develop that project. The Cooperators° decide democratically on the projects to be implemented by the CosmoPolitical Cooperative and the share of common resources to be allocated to them.
  3. Our long-term goal, the Society of Agreement, ensures consistency between the actions carried out by the CosmoPolitical Cooperative and their convergence: all our actions contribute, in their own way, to the realisation of the Society of Agreement. In this spirit, the CosmoPolitical Cooperative also supports any action taken by an external organisation that moves towards the Society of Agreement.
  4. We prioritise actions, such as our first project on a sustainable diet, which:
    • are concrete and effective solutions for improving in a significant way social justice, environmental sustainability, or democratic participation at European level; and/or
    • deliver visible and concrete results in the short term, particularly because they can be decided with the agreement of only a small number of people, with little or no investment; and/or
    • can be implemented by a small group of people who encourage each other; and/or
    • act on an essential lock of the current system, which, once removed, will have a cascade of positive effects.
  5. Thanks to our status as a European cooperative, we are able to mobilise a very wide range of means of action:
    • like an association;
    • like a trade union;
    • like a company and
    • like a political organisation.
  6. We ensure the replication of the actions we carry out, drawing on our European dimension. Each action is accompanied by a "How to" manual, available under a free licence (such as our Sustainable Diet Handbook), so that everyone, even outside the Cooperative, can replicate this action elsewhere than where it was first carried out. This "How to" manual includes recommendations for success, as well as the mistakes we made and the lessons we learned from them. The Cooperative supports not only completely innovative projects, but also the replication, in a new context, and in particular in a new Member State of the European Union, of actions initiated elsewhere.

(*) Members of our Community are all persons registered on our platform.

(°) Cooperators are members of the Community whose identity has been verified, who have registered only once (in accordance with the democratic principle of "1 person = 1 vote"), who are citizens of the European Union of legal age, who have purchased at least one share in the Cooperative and who have paid their yearly contribution.
